Sunk-cost bias-money already spent seems to justify continuing.The sunk-cost bias is sometimes called the "Concorde" effect,referring to the fact that the French and British governments continued to invest in the Concorde supersonic jetliner even when it was evident there was no economic justification for the aircraft.
